Setting Up Camp

The first step in bushcraft is finding a suitable location to set up camp. Look for a flat area with access to water and natural shelter from the elements. Use natural materials like branches and leaves to construct your shelter.

Fire Making

Fire is essential for keeping warm, cooking food, and signaling for help in an emergency. Learn how to make a fire using friction-based methods like the bow drill or flint and steel.

Foraging and Hunting

Foraging for edible plants and hunting for food are crucial skills in bushcraft. Learn how to identify edible plants and track game for a sustainable food source.

Navigation

Being able to navigate through the wilderness is essential for finding your way back to civilization. Use a compass and map to plot your course or learn how to navigate using natural landmarks.
